Darksiders -- Initial Impression.
Next up for me is the action game Darksiders. I'll be playing the PlayStation 3 version of the game. Darksiders is the first effort from developer Vigil Games and has been published by THQ. I really have to say that Darksiders had been off my radar entirely up until a few weeks ago. Neo had mentioned it a few times but I really didn't pay it any attention. Then Riddel was all excited about it a few weeks ago describing it as heavily inspired by the Zelda series. So I looked into the game a bit and all I kept seeing was dark Zelda this and adult Zelda that. I have to say that intrigued me. The story also seemed rather interesting. You play as War, one of the four horsemen of the apocalypse. In the bible, the seals are broken and the each of the horsemen are called. In the game, War hears his call and answers it only to find angels and demons waging war on Earth. Nobody seems to understand what's going on and it seems that there never really was a call. Someone or something has set him up and he's actually jumped the gun and brought the apocalypse early. He's then tasked with finding out the truth. It's a rather interesting concept and premise. From the time I've spent with the game so far I can say the game is really good looking. The enemy designs are great. I don't know how to feel about the main character and the angels yet. They look like World of Warcraft rejects. The voice work initially comes off as great. It's always good to hear Mark Hamill hamming it up. I haven't played enough of the game to see how Zelda like the game is going to turn out to be. The combat initially seems like it falls well within the standard action territory along the lines of God of War. It's too early to tell how this one is going to fall but I have to say I'm rather interested to see either way at this point.
